The EPA 2008 Wetlands and Watersheds Conference is intended to convene individuals with an interest in conserving and protecting watersheds, wetlands, streams, and riparian areas particularly within the Iowa, Kansas, Missouri and Nebraska region.

The EPA 2008 Wetlands and Watersheds Conference will provide a diversity of venues to maximize networking and information exchange on the latest scientific issues, policies and regulations, technical topics, and model projects.

 

Who Should Attend?

Attendees at the meeting will consist of representatives from watershed groups, states (including wetlands coordinators, 404 staff, non-point source programs, watershed coordinators, and 319 coordinators), federal agencies, tribes, local governments, special interest groups, developers, consultants, and students.
